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
-
In a large bowl, combine the flour, baking powder, and salt.
-
In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, and vegetable oil.
-
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ined.
-
Fold in the cheddar cheese, cooked bacon, green onions, bell pepper, tomato, and spinach.
-
Divide the batter evenly among a greased muffin tin.
-
Bake for 20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ean.
-
Allow the muffins to cool for 5 minutes before removing from the tin.
-
Serve warm or at room temperature.
